The Prospective Industry Research Institute released a report titled "China's Machine Vision Industry Development Prospects and Investment Analysis," highlighting the rapid growth of the global machine vision industry. In 2015, the market size for machine vision systems and components reached $4.2 billion, and it is projected to exceed $5 billion by 2018. This growth reflects the increasing adoption of machine vision across various sectors.

According to the event organizers, machine vision is a key branch of artificial intelligence. In simple terms, it involves using machines to perform tasks that would traditionally require human vision, such as measurement and decision-making. The responsible party emphasized that machine vision is often referred to as the "eye" of smart manufacturing, playing a crucial role in boosting productivity and automation. As industries undergo transformation and smart manufacturing advances, the demand for machine vision technology continues to rise.
A machine vision system uses image capture devices to convert target objects into image signals, which are then sent to a specialized processing system. This system extracts morphological information, converting the image signals into digital data based on pixel distribution, brightness, and color.
Machine vision is a combination of both hardware and software, with key components including cameras, image sensors, visual processing units, and communication equipment. A complete system can capture images of any object and analyze them based on various parameters like quality and safety.
At the Huarui Technology booth, representatives shared details about the company’s latest innovation: the CoaXPress large-area array industrial camera, which is the world's first 50-megapixel industrial camera. It uses the CMV50000 image sensor, achieving an ultra-high resolution of 7920×6004 with a frame rate of 30 fps. The enhanced image quality allows for clearer details, making it suitable for applications such as visual inspection, electronics, PCBs, railway testing, LCD screens, and glass covers. Additionally, Huarui Technology partnered with Movidius to launch the world's first Myriad2 platform smart industrial camera. The 7000 series area array industrial cameras feature Sony’s latest IMX global exposure CMOS sensors, offering high adaptability for industrial-grade use.
During the exhibition, it was evident that machine vision is gaining traction in the security sector. Haikang Technology displayed a range of innovative products, including 10GbE network cameras and VPU platform smart cameras, which are widely used in Haikang robots. Meanwhile, Beijing Qingying Machine Vision Technology Co., Ltd. introduced its "Universal Three-Dimensional Instant Imaging Technology," known for its "universal" and "instant" features, filling a gap in the domestic machine vision market.
